Handover note — to receiving, Calder Point

Dena,

The key-card stock for the new Calder Point site ships today: three sealed cartons, 500 blanks each, tamper tape intact on all sides. Verify seal numbers against the packing sheet before signing. Any broken seal means refuse the carton and flag it to security. The courier hand-over must follow the confidential instruction given directly below this note.

drop instructions, yafog-yawip: the quenmir olidor courier leaves the julox tamion keliel ledger at gate 5283 under passcode 336825

## InvoiceForge Onboarding

InvoiceForge renders PDF invoices for the Tallowbrook billing stack. Templates live in the `layouts` repo; don't edit generated output by hand. Rendering runs in a sandboxed worker — no network, fonts bundled. Builds are deterministic; if checksums drift, your template changed, not the renderer.

For access: request a role grant from the platform lead. If the signing vault locks during onboarding (common), you'll need the recovery passphrase, which is kept directly below this line.

unlock words, kahif-bajep: druix-sormir-fenys

**Handover: Pylonix Metrics Sidecar**

For the weekly sync: the sidecar now batches counters every 15s instead of 5s, cutting upstream load on the Drennick aggregator by roughly 60%. Histogram merging still drops buckets under high cardinality — a fix is staged but unreviewed. Memory cap is pinned at 256Mi; raising it requires a capacity review. Deploy rollout is paused at 40% pending soak results. Ongoing ownership transfers to the person named below.

account owner for bawip-tahag: Raleth Quenok

# Break-Glass Access — ChipGate Reader

This page covers emergency access to the Fennick Racing timing-chip reader fleet. If the ChipGate admin console is unreachable on race morning, the release manager may invoke break-glass to push a hotfix directly to readers. Log the incident in the ops journal within 24 hours. To unlock the break-glass credential store, enter the passphrase below.

unlock words, yageg-faweg: briael-quenox-rusox